HOW TO USE:
- Preparation: Ensure you are wearing appropriate safety gear, including safety glasses and gloves, before beginning work.
- Tool Assembly: Insert the .401″ round shank of the Mayhew 3/4″ Pneumatic Spot Weld Breaker into the chuck of your pneumatic air hammer, ensuring it is securely seated.
- Air Connection: Connect your air hammer to a regulated compressed air supply. Set the air pressure according to your air hammer’s recommendations and the requirements of the job.
- Positioning: Place the blade of the spot weld breaker directly over the center of the spot weld you intend to break.
- Activation: While maintaining firm pressure on the tool against the workpiece, activate your air hammer. The rapid percussive action will apply force to the weld, causing it to separate.
- Repositioning: If the weld does not break on the first attempt, slightly adjust the tool’s position and repeat the process until the weld is cleanly separated.
- Post-Use: Once the task is complete, disconnect the tool from the air hammer and clean any debris from the blade before storing.
